Proposed location of Biblical Gilgal, in the modern-day West Bank According to Joshua 4:19, Gilgal is a location "on the eastern border of Jericho " where the Israelites encamped immediately after crossing the Jordan River. Here 12 memorial stones taken from the bed of the river were set up by Joshua, after the miraculous crossing of the Jordan; and here the people were circumcised preparatory to their possession of the land, when it is said in Joshua, with a play upon the word, "This day have I rolled away the reproach of Egypt from off you."
